Possible Causes of Water Damage in Pinckney

Water leaks in Pinckney can stem from a variety of sources, often catching property owners off guard. One common cause is aging plumbing systems that develop leaks over time, especially if they haven’t been maintained properly. Frost during Michigan winters can cause pipes to crack or burst, leading to significant water intrusion. Additionally, deteriorating roof seals or damaged shingles can allow rainwater to seep into your home, especially during heavy storms.

Another prevalent cause involves appliance failures, such as malfunctioning dishwashers, washing machines, or water heaters. These appliances, if not regularly checked, can leak and cause water to accumulate behind walls or under flooring. Faulty or clogged gutters can overflow during storms, directing excess water against your exterior walls and foundation, leading to seepage or structural water damage. Recognizing these causes early can help prevent extensive damage and costly repairs.

Can water damage lead to mold growth?

Yes, if moisture remains within walls, floors, or furniture for more than 48 hours, mold can develop. That’s why prompt water extraction and drying are critical. Our experts take preventative measures to eliminate moisture and prevent mold proliferation.
